It's been about 18 months since my visit with Yoda (March 05) and 12 months since a tune-up with Ted Fort (Sep 05). I also ran into Chuck Evans in, of all places, Opelika,AL and he gave me a quick 10 minute range session this April. When I first saw Lynn my index was 9.8 with an average score of about 85---and I had been stuck there for about 3 years. Since then I have continued to follow this forum regularly and absorb everything I can, from the excellent posts to the great videos. I picked up my most recent USGA handicap card yesterday and my index is down to 6.1 and my average score is 81.9. I have always enjoyed playing golf, but playing well is really a treat. It's so nice winning $$ from my buddies on Sat mornings for a change. I have NEVER hit the ball so far and so accurately. I still have a few stupid moments and an occasional clunker round, but not many. What's amazing is how much 12-5-0 seems to have helped my short game. Homer Kelley was brilliant and the people who teach his findings are special. There is a reason Lynn has added another tour player to his fold and why Ted is the Georgia PGA Teacher of the Year. The secret is in the book, and the words are brought to life by these gentlemen. I am living proof. Go to The Swamp and experience the magic.
